BRITs Week 25 announces money raised for War Child

Headliners of the intimate concert series included Cat Burns, Rachel Chinouriri, Kasabian and Rag'n'Bone Man

Organisers of BRITs Week 25 have revealed the series of concerts raised £650,000 (€776,761) for War Child.

The 11 intimate one-off performances were held across London, as well as Glasgow and Bexhill-on-Sea in February and March, with all proceeds going towards War Child’s work to help children whose lives have been devastatingly affected by war.
